Maine is a favorite place for us to visit. Julie was a camp counselor their in her younger days and Rainer has retreated to Hancock Point on several occasions to write books. On this trip we took the Old Canada Road north and then went across the state to Baxter State Park. Next we traveled to Eastport and Lubec with a quick trip to Roosevelt's Campobello International Park just inside the Canadian border. Then we followed the coastline to Bar Harbor and spent a day enjoying Acadia National Park, one of our very favorite places to hike and bike.
